Technology

Technology has become an integral part of our lives, shaping the way we live, work, and communicate. It refers to the tools, machines, and systems that are created to solve problems and make our lives easier. From the invention of the wheel to the development of smartphones, technology has evolved and transformed the world in unimaginable ways.

One of the most significant impacts of technology is its ability to improve efficiency and productivity. Machines and automation have replaced manual labor in many industries, allowing tasks to be completed faster and with greater accuracy. For example, in the manufacturing sector, robots are used to assemble products, reducing the need for human workers and increasing production rates. This not only saves time but also reduces costs for businesses.

Moreover, technology has revolutionized communication. The invention of the telephone, followed by the internet and smartphones, has made it possible for people to connect with each other instantly, regardless of their geographical location. Social media platforms have further enhanced communication by allowing individuals to share their thoughts, ideas, and experiences with a global audience. This has opened up new opportunities for collaboration, learning, and cultural exchange.

In the field of healthcare, technology has played a crucial role in improving diagnosis and treatment. Advanced medical equipment and imaging techniques have made it easier for doctors to identify diseases and conditions accurately. Surgeries have become less invasive, thanks to the development of robotic-assisted surgical systems. Telemedicine has also emerged as a convenient way for patients to consult with doctors remotely, especially in rural areas where access to healthcare facilities is limited.

Education has also been transformed by technology. Traditional classrooms are no longer the only option for learning. Online courses and e-learning platforms have made education accessible to a wider audience, breaking down barriers of time and location. Students can now access educational resources, collaborate with peers, and receive personalized feedback from teachers, all through the use of technology. This has revolutionized the way knowledge is acquired and shared.

However, technology is not without its drawbacks. The overreliance on technology has led to a sedentary lifestyle, contributing to health issues such as obesity and musculoskeletal disorders. The constant exposure to screens and digital devices has also raised concerns about the impact on mental health, with increased rates of anxiety and depression being reported. Additionally, the rapid pace of technological advancements has created a digital divide, with certain populations being left behind due to lack of access or knowledge.

In conclusion, technology has become an indispensable part of our lives, bringing numerous benefits and opportunities. It has improved efficiency, communication, healthcare, and education, making our lives easier and more connected. However, it is important to strike a balance and be mindful of the potential negative impacts. By harnessing the power of technology responsibly, we can continue to shape a future where technology serves as a tool for progress and human well-being.

  • The invention of the wheel is one of the earliest examples of technology that revolutionized transportation. Before its creation, humans relied on their own physical strength or the use of animals to move heavy objects or travel long distances. However, with the introduction of the wheel, a whole new world of possibilities opened up. It allowed for the development of carts, chariots, and eventually vehicles, making transportation faster, more efficient, and accessible to a larger population. The wheel truly transformed the way people moved and transported goods, paving the way for future advancements in transportation technology.

  • Cryptocurrencies and blockchain technology are revolutionizing the financial industry by introducing decentralized digital currencies and secure transactions. This innovative technology has the potential to disrupt traditional banking systems, as it eliminates the need for intermediaries and allows for peer-to-peer transactions. With cryptocurrencies like Bitcoin gaining mainstream acceptance, individuals and businesses are embracing this new form of digital currency, which offers transparency, immutability, and enhanced security. The blockchain technology behind cryptocurrencies ensures that transactions are recorded on a distributed ledger, making it nearly impossible to alter or manipulate data, thus providing a level of trust and reliability previously unseen in the financial industry.

  • The development of gene editing technology, like CRISPR-Cas9, offers potential advancements in genetic research and medicine. This revolutionary tool allows scientists to precisely modify DNA sequences, opening up possibilities for treating genetic diseases, improving crop yields, and even preventing the spread of certain viruses. With its ability to target specific genes and make precise changes, CRISPR-Cas9 has the potential to revolutionize the field of medicine by providing personalized treatments and therapies. Additionally, it has the potential to enhance our understanding of genetic diseases and their underlying mechanisms, leading to the development of more effective treatments and interventions.
